To start, understanding your specialization is essential. The internet is flooded with content, so focusing on a specific niche helps you stand out. Whether your niche is wellness, business, or travel, selecting a niche allows you to target a particular audience who shares an interest in your content. By narrowing your focus, you can develop expertise and build a reputation as a trusted source of information. This approach increases the chances of attracting clients, boosting your credibility, and establishing a strong online presence.
Next, it’s important to optimize your content for SEO platforms.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is crucial for getting your articles discovered online. SEO involves optimizing your content with the right keywords, structuring it in a way that appeals to both readers and search engines, and ensuring it is easily accessible. By incorporating SEO best practices, such as using targeted phrases, internal links, and clear headings, you can increase your content's visibility on platforms like Google. This not only drives organic traffic but also makes your work more appealing to potential clients who are looking for well-written and SEO-friendly content.

Creating a portfolio is another essential step in writing online. Prospective clients want to see your work before engaging you, so having a collection of your best pieces is essential. If you're just starting, consider writing guest posts, drafting mock articles, or even providing free work in exchange for feedback or samples. As you advance in your career, make sure to highlight your versatility and proficiency across varied types of content. Over time, a solid portfolio will increase your chances of landing paid writing gigs.
In addition with developing your skills, networking plays an crucial role in securing writing jobs. There are many platforms where freelance writers can connect with clients, such as Freelancer. These platforms allow you to create a profile, submit proposals, and compete for gigs. Additionally, joining author groups and participating in forums can help you discover fresh gigs and network with professionals and businesses. Networking also helps establish credibility, as satisfied clients often refer you to others.
Setting your rates as an online writer requires careful analysis and a detailed understanding of the market. Freelance writing rates differ based on criteria such as your skills, niche, and the scope of the projects. When starting, it may be tempting to take on lower-paying jobs to build your portfolio. However, over time, it is important to raise your rates to reflect your growing experience and skill set. Research the standard pay for writers in your niche and use that as a reference for pricing your services. Be transparent with clients about your rates and any additional costs for rush jobs or extra revisions.
